About the Role
We are seeking a highly experienced and strategic leader to take on the role of Corporate Lead – Transportation.
As the Council’s strategic lead for transportation, you will provide leadership and direction for a multidisciplinary service of approximately 35 professionals, ensuring Calderdale is recognised for best practice, innovation and value for money.
The role is responsible for:
- Leading the development and delivery of transportation policies, strategies and delivery programmes.
- Managing annual revenue budgets in excess of £1m and a capital programme of approximately £80m
- Providing expert advice to elected members and senior managers
- Representing Calderdale at the West Yorkshire Combined Authority and working with regional partners
- Driving innovation to address challenges such as congestion, road safety, air quality and climate change
- Represent Calderdale at key forums including the West Yorkshire Combined Authority, influencing regional initiatives such as Bus reform, Mass transit and Active travel
You will also contribute to the wider leadership of the Strategic Infrastructure service and support delivery of the Council’s priorities.
